Havelock North

At our Havelock North centre, there is plenty of open space, providing an environment which is such that children learn to play and use their imagination more freely.

They enjoy a myriad of outdoor experiences, including archery, adventurous creek explorations, street hockey, cricket and soccer coaching sessions.

Children tend to create a wider circle of friends who attend the programme from different schools. The programme specialises in providing varied art and craft projects, and life experiences, like sewing and baking.

Details

The programme content includes on a daily basis:

  • Club K programme age specific for our Senior children
  • Free play
  • Nutritious and varied afternoon tea
  • Planned craft and art time daily
  • Variety of arts and craft material to use
  • Organised sport or active game
  • Organised group quiet game or activity
  • T.V
  • Playstation
  • Homework time
  • Winter-time hot drinks
  • Baking
  • Water Fun – Water slide, water guns, sprinklers
  • Excursions
  • Specialised Visitors

Children will be encouraged to participate in planned activities, but may choose not to. There are always alternative activities for them to participate in.

The programme plan is child focused, varied, stimulating and challenging. The plan aims to meet the physical needs of every child.

The programme contents is reviewed every 4 weeks at staff meetings.
